To enable the wireless AP feature on the Cisco FM4200 Fiber, do the
steps that follow:
1. Make sure the FM-AP software plug-in is installed on the radio
unit. For instructions on how to install the FM-AP plug-in, refer to
"Plug-in management procedures" (page
2. Open the CISCO 802.11 INTERFACE dialog (below) by
clicking the –Cisco WiFi link under ADVANCED SETTINGS
in the left-hand settings menu.
To configure the radio unit as a bridged or routed wireless access point
(AP), do the following steps:
1. Configure the radio unit as a wireless access point by clicking the
WLAN MODE drop-down menu and selecting the AP option.
• The CISCO 802.11 INTERFACE dialog will show
additional options (below):
